4个回答
展开全部
要用到NEWID()生成的36位数据作为主键?这是为何,36位不能转化成32位吧,直接转换空间不足的,要么用SUBSTRING或则LEFT,RIGHT截取。SELECT
LEFT(NEWID(),32)--
LEFT(NEWID(),32)--
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2013-08-08
展开全部
select left(newid(),32)
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2013-08-08
展开全部
select replace(newid(),'-','')
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2013-08-08
展开全部
你们俩太有意思了,离那么近还用qq问答,我。。。。。。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询